Is Chicharito going to make a return to the Premier League after all?
That's the story that's making the rounds today. However by the looks of it he won't be heading back to United after his loan spell with Real Madrid comes to an end. Well, not Manchester United anyway...
Via the Independent:
West Ham are hoping they can sign Manchester United striker Javier Hernandez. The Mexican is currently on loan with Real Madrid where he has scored four goals in 16 appearances but his lack of game time suggests the 26-year-old will not be kept on beyond this season. Louis van Gaal has a wealth of options at his disposal at Old Trafford meaning Hernandez could slip between the two clubs. According to Spanish newspaper AS, West Ham are monitoring the situation. Hernandez has 18 months left on his United contract.
